Output 43d258381dff90fc22a5781958105c2b3aab9c253468e6adcd158c5f5f922f86:4

value
19505412467
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23f1cd9d110d7284a9c1d68fd5a75555072c5bbb OP_EQUALVERIFY OP_CHECKSIG
address
D8R9rkZT2LviWXsyHPoQ3zA8FgpUEkohjg
transaction
43d258381dff90fc22a5781958105c2b3aab9c253468e6adcd158c5f5f922f86